In an exciting cricket matchup, Afghanistan has decided to bat first against South Africa. They’re looking to build on their recent win. In the last game, Afghanistan really impressed everyone by knocking South Africa down to just 36 runs for 7 wickets. With a chance to win the series, Afghanistan’s eager to grab this win and show how strong they are on the world stage.

Weather & Game Plan

The game takes place in Sharjah, where it’s super hot, feeling like 49 degrees Celsius. This intense heat might be a big reason why Afghanistan chose to bat first. By batting during the day and bowling at night, they could save some energy, especially since South Africa has to deal with the heat too. Players need to stay hydrated and maintain their stamina in these tough conditions.

Team Changes & Lineup News

South Africa is making two important changes in their team, bringing back captain Temba Bavuma after he got better from being sick. His comeback lifts everyone’s spirits and adds much-needed guidance on the field. With Bavuma back, the batting order shifts; Reeza Hendricks moves down to No. 3 and Jason Smith is left out of the squad.

The bowling plan has changed too! Instead of four seam bowlers & one spinner like last time, they’re now going with three seamers & two specialist spinners. Nqaba Peter makes his debut as a legspinner, giving them more spinning options that might work well since the pitch usually favors spin bowlers.

For Afghanistan,

they’ve decided not to play Gulbadin Naib, who was key in their last win. Instead, Ikram Alikhil steps in as wicketkeeper-batter. This shows they want a balanced team with three main spinners Rashid Khan, AM Ghazanfar, & Nangyal Kharote plus two seamers. Their batting looks solid with stars like Rahmanullah Gurbaz & Hashmatullah Shahidi ready to score big runs.

Afghanistan’s Team:

  • Rahmanullah Gurbaz (wk)
  • Riaz Hassan
  • Rahmat Shah
  • Hashmatullah Shahidi (capt)
  • Mohammed Nabi
  • Ikram Alikhil
  • Azmatullah Omarzai
  • Rashid Khan
  • AM Ghazanfar
  • Fazalhaq Farooqi
  • Nangyal Kharote

South Africa’s Team:

  • Tony de Zorzi
  • Temba Bavuma (capt)
  • Reeza Hendricks
  • Aiden Markram
  • Tristan Stubbs
  • Kyle Verreynne (wk)
  • Wiaan Mulder
  • Bjorn Fortuin
  • Nandre Burger
  • Nqaba Peter
  • Lungi Ngidi
